Deposit threshold variation
Minimum deposit requirements range from $10 at accessible services targeting casual participants to $50-100 at premium operations focusing on higher-value audiences. Low thresholds democratize access, letting anyone test services through modest commitments before scaling involvement. High minimums create barriers, excluding budget-conscious participants or those wanting small initial trials. Threshold policies signal target demographics where low minimums indicate mass-market approaches while high floors suggest VIP focus.
Withdrawal minimum gaps
Cash-out floors vary from $20 at participant-friendly services to $100+ at operations prioritising large transactions over small convenience withdrawals. Low minimums enable regular small withdrawals matching casual play patterns without forcing balance accumulation. High thresholds frustrate small-stakes participants who are unable to reach minimums through modest winnings. Minimum policies sometimes get justified as offsetting processing costs, though blockchain expenses rarely justify $50-100 floors. Reasonable minimums around $20-30 balance operational efficiency against participant convenience.
Maximum limit ranges
Daily withdrawal caps span from $5,000 at conservative operations to unlimited at progressive services, trusting participant legitimacy. Restrictive caps frustrate winning participants, forcing them to split large payouts across multiple days. Generous limits accommodate big winners accessing funds promptly without artificial delays from arbitrary restrictions. Cap policies reveal risk management philosophies where tight limits indicate caution, while loose limits demonstrate confidence in security systems. Account age or volume-based limit increases reward established participants with enhanced flexibility.
Processing timeframe differs
Instant automated processing completes withdrawals within 5-15 minutes through smart contract execution, eliminating manual approval queues. Manual review operations impose 24-48 hour delays where staff individually examine requests during business hours. Weekend processing gaps extend waits when manual services pause operations Friday evening through Monday morning. Timeframe consistency matters where predictable speeds enable planning versus variable processing, creating uncertainty. Processing philosophies separate participant-first automated services from conservative manual approaches, prioritising internal processes over user convenience.
Verification requirement levels
Light documentation services process initial withdrawals with minimal verification, requiring only email addresses without identity documents. Heavy verification operations demand government IDs, utility bills, selfie photos, and sometimes income proof before approving any cash-outs. First-withdrawal verification triggers differ, where some services request documents upfront while others allow initial gaming, then require verification at cash-out attempts. Enhanced due diligence applies to large amounts where services are requesting additional documentation above certain thresholds.
Account tier privileges
Standard accounts face restrictive policies with low maximums, high minimums, and slower processing reflecting elevated perceived risks. VIP tiers earned through wagering volume enjoy relaxed thresholds, higher limits, and priority processing. Elite status often eliminates most restrictions, providing nearly unlimited withdrawal flexibility. Progression systems create loyalty incentives where participants advancing through tiers receive tangible policy improvements.
Transparent tier requirements let participants calculate the exact activity needed to reach the next levels. Privilege structures recognise participant lifetime value by investing in retention through meaningful policy benefits.
